The following information concerns rights and procedures that relate to this proceeding for the termination of parental rights pursuant to Family Code Sections 7860 et seq.: 1. Any person having the custody or control of the child, or the person with whom the child is with, is required to appear at the above-stated time and place of the hearing; 2. At the beginning of the proceeding the Court will consider whether or not the interest of EMMA ROSE YOUNG requires the appointment of counsel. If the court finds that the interest of the child does require such protection, the Court will appoint counsel to represent the child, whether or not the minor is able to afford counsel; 3. This petition is filed for the purpose of freeing the child from custody and control and to terminate parental rights; 4. Under Family Code Section 7862, If a parent appears without counsel and is unable to afford counsel, the court shall appoint counsel for the parent, unless that representation is knowingly and intelligently waived; 5. Under Family Code Section 7864, the court may continue the proceeding not to exceed 30 days as necessary to appoint counsel and to enable counsel to become acquainted with the case; 6. Under Family Law Code Section 7883, if a person personally served with a citation within this state as provided in Section 7880 fails without reasonable cause to appear and abide by the order of the court, or to bring the child before the court if so required in the citation, the failure constitutes a contempt of court.
